diff --git a/modular_doppler/modular_items/icons/belt_lefthand.dmi b/modular_doppler/modular_items/icons/belt_lefthand.dmi new file mode 100644 index 0000000000000..e6bac902cd3b2 Binary files /dev/null and b/modular_doppler/modular_items/icons/belt_lefthand.dmi differ diff --git a/modular_doppler/modular_items/icons/belt_righthand.dmi b/modular_doppler/modular_items/icons/belt_righthand.dmi new file mode 100644 index 0000000000000..553c0d4b3861e Binary files /dev/null and b/modular_doppler/modular_items/icons/belt_righthand.dmi differ diff --git a/modular_doppler/modular_items/icons/belts.dmi b/modular_doppler/modular_items/icons/belts.dmi new file mode 100644 index 0000000000000..be60838ecf1f1 Binary files /dev/null and b/modular_doppler/modular_items/icons/belts.dmi differ diff --git a/modular_doppler/modular_items/invisible_gear.dm b/modular_doppler/modular_items/invisible_gear.dm new file mode 100644 index 0000000000000..d8bbd40b42fb7 --- /dev/null +++ b/modular_doppler/modular_items/invisible_gear.dm @@ -0,0 +1,34 @@ +/obj/item/storage/belt/utility/invisible + name = "compact toolbelt" + desc = "Holds tools. but is more easily hidden underneeth clothing." + icon_state = "compact_utility" + inhand_icon_state = "compact_utility" + worn_icon_state = "hidden_icon" + worn_icon = 'modular_doppler/modular_items/icons/belts.dmi' + custom_premium_price = PAYCHECK_CREW * 1.5 + icon = 'modular_doppler/modular_items/icons/belts.dmi' + lefthand_file = 'modular_doppler/modular_items/icons/belt_lefthand.dmi' + righthand_file = 'modular_doppler/modular_items/icons/belt_righthand.dmi' + +/obj/item/storage/belt/utility/invisible/Initialize(mapload) + . = ..() + atom_storage.max_total_storage = 12 + atom_storage.max_slots = 5 + +/obj/item/storage/belt/medical/invisible + name = "compact medical belt" + desc = "Can hold various medical equipment. Its smaller size makes it easier to hide under clothing." + icon_state = "compact_medical" + inhand_icon_state = "compact_utility" + worn_icon_state = "hidden_icon" + worn_icon = 'modular_doppler/modular_items/icons/belts.dmi' + icon = 'modular_doppler/modular_items/icons/belts.dmi' + lefthand_file = 'modular_doppler/modular_items/icons/belt_lefthand.dmi' + righthand_file = 'modular_doppler/modular_items/icons/belt_righthand.dmi' + + +/obj/item/storage/belt/medical/invisible/Initialize(mapload) + . = ..() + atom_storage.max_total_storage = 12 + atom_storage.max_slots = 5 + diff --git a/tgstation.dme b/tgstation.dme index f36213a170dc7..c46bc90a16e7e 100644 --- a/tgstation.dme +++ b/tgstation.dme @@ -6485,6 +6485,7 @@ #include "modular_doppler\modular_food_drinks_and_chems\food_and_drinks\drink_reagents.dm" #include "modular_doppler\modular_food_drinks_and_chems\food_and_drinks\drinks.dm" #include "modular_doppler\modular_food_drinks_and_chems\food_and_drinks\drinks_recipes.dm" +#include "modular_doppler\modular_items\invisible_gear.dm" #include "modular_doppler\modular_mob_spawn\code\mob_spawn.dm" #include "modular_doppler\modular_sounds\code\sounds.dm" #include "modular_doppler\modular_traits\code\neutral.dm"